Book excerpt: Excerpt from The African Repository, and Colonial Journal, Vol. 8: November, 1832 Mr. Clarkson then proceeds to speak of the mode and means by which African colonization may be urged forward on a scale sufficiently magnificent and Splendid to effect these great results. He believes the Spirit of God is disposing thou sands of benevolent and pious men in our country, to liberate their slaves, and aid in their establishment as freemen in Africa. He thinks this work of humanity may be liberally assisted by the contributions of the good and pious of England. He expects the churches and congregations of the United States will be roused to great zeal and effort to promote it.
